You can use form T778: Child care expenses deduction to claim child care expenses you paid for your child(ren) in 2023. You can claim child care expenses if you or your spouse or common-law partner paid someone to look after an eligible child so that you (or both of you) can: Earn income from employment.
Put their name, address, and phone number. State the name of the provider and the service provided, which is child care. Then, write the agreed-on form of payment received for these services (like cash, credit card, or check) and when these payments are due (monthly, weekly, bi-weekly, etc.)
If you determine that you are self-employed, report your income from daycare as business income on your income tax and benefit return. Enter your gross daycare income on line 13499 1, and your net income or loss on line 13500 2.

Include the name and contact information of the daycare center in the designated section. Include the name and contact information of the parent or guardian who is making the payment. Clearly state the amount paid for daycare services. If there are any additional charges or fees, specify them separately on the receipt.
You need to be able to verify childcare expenses in case of an audit. If you dont have proof that you paid these expenses, you cant claim the credit. You dont have to bring the receipts to your tax pro or mail them with your return. Just keep them with your personal records for at least three years.
For s FAQs Start by filling in the childs name, date of birth, and address. Include the name and address of the child care provider. Fill in the start and end dates of the child care period. Write in the hours of care and the amount paid.
